Transaction 37c4e645d4058ee35bdef980452bd56e3d37e1adf469bf9504f515bfed8d6885

1 Input
2 Outputs
  • 37c4e645d4058ee35bdef980452bd56e3d37e1adf469bf9504f515bfed8d6885:0
  • value  25000000
    address  2MugysdTDtihyY5MV6XZFg8L23ym66mP8BS
  • 37c4e645d4058ee35bdef980452bd56e3d37e1adf469bf9504f515bfed8d6885:1
  • value  186867693330
    address  2NBAa9kqr53JSSqYCUKhkN1trDAFKyLwLDG